推荐应用
解决DiscuzX系统提醒信息过多带来对应数据表性能低下的问题
发布于 2013-07-13
DiscuzX改进的提醒功能非常好用,现在各种插件和系统本身的诸多行为都会向用户推送提醒,久而久之,这个表就相对较大了,一些性能较差的机器上很可能遇到这个表查询很卡的情况,这里给一个手动清理提醒信息的SQL语句,扔到数据库里面执行了就行,DZ后台就可以执行SQL语句的。
DELETE FROM pre_home_notification WHERE dateline < 1356969600 AND new = 0
pre_home_notification是表名,自己注意改一下前缀,new是是否已读,1为未读,0为已读,dateline是时间,保存的是一个Unix时间戳,我们可以使用这个转换工具转换一下即可,http://www.discuzlab.com/tool.chinaz.com/Tools/unixtime.aspx